What are IQF Herbs?

IQF herbs are derived from freshly picked herbs that are quickly frozen at very low temperatures. This method locks in their essential oils and flavors, making them a viable alternative to fresh herbs. IQF herbs are often available in various forms, including whole leaves or finely chopped, and can be used in a variety of culinary settings.

Advantages of IQF Herbs

  1. Convenience:

    • No washing, chopping, or prepping required.
    • Easily portioned for various recipes.
  2. Long Shelf Life:

    • IQF herbs can be stored for extended periods without losing flavor or nutritional value.
    • Reduces waste due to spoilage, which can occur with fresh herbs.
  3. Nutritional Value:

    • Preserves more nutrients compared to dried herbs.
    • Contains the taste and health benefits associated with fresh herbs.
  4. Versatility in Cooking:

    • Perfect for soups, stews, marinades, sauces, and dressings.
    • Easy to incorporate into both everyday meals and gourmet dishes.

Common Uses of IQF Herbs in Global Cuisine

  • Italian Dishes: Add IQF basil, oregano, or parsley to pastas and pizzas for authentic flavor.

  • Mexican Cuisine: Utilize IQF cilantro in salsas or guacamole for that fresh, zesty kick.

  • Asian Fare: Incorporate IQF green onions or dill in stir-fries for a burst of flavor.

  • Middle Eastern Meals: Use IQF mint and parsley in tabbouleh or as a garnish for kebabs.

Practical Suggestions for Using IQF Herbs

  1. Storage Tips:

    • Keep IQF herbs in their original packaging or airtight containers to avoid freezer burn.
    • Store them in the freezer and do not refreeze after thawing.
  2. Cooking Methods:

    • Add IQF herbs directly to frozen dishes without thawing.
    • When cooking, toss them into soups or stews early on to release their flavors.
  3. Combining with Other Ingredients:

    • Blend IQF herbs into marinades for meats to enhance flavor.
    • Sprinkle them on top of dishes prior to serving for a fresh finishing touch.

Troubleshooting FAQ

Q1: How do I measure IQF herbs for cooking?

A1: Use the same volume measurement as you would with fresh herbs, but remember that the flavor might be more potent in raw form. Start with a smaller amount and adjust according to taste.

Q2: Can I replace dried herbs with IQF herbs?

A2: Yes, but you’d need to use a larger quantity of IQF herbs. A general rule is to use three times more IQF herbs than dried.

Q3: Do I need to chop IQF herbs before using them?

A3: No, IQF herbs can be used directly. If they are whole leaves, you may want to chop them depending on your recipe.
